Is Boxlight Corp (BOXL) a Good Investment?
Boxlight faces critical financial distress with negative stockholders equity of -$2.0M, persistent operating losses, and negative free cash flow of -$5.1M, raising fundamental solvency concerns. The company cannot sustain itself from operational cash generation while carrying $34.1M in debt against a declining $22.4M revenue base, creating an unsustainable capital structure.
Boxlight's fundamentals are weak: revenue is contracting sharply, margins remain deeply negative, and the balance sheet is strained by negative equity, meaningful debt, and thin liquidity. While free cash flow burn is relatively modest versus revenue and net loss improved slightly year over year, the overall quality of the business remains poor because losses persist alongside declining sales and weak interest coverage.

BOXL Quarterly Earnings & Performance
| Quarter | Revenue | Net Income | EPS |
|---|---|---|---|
| Q1 2026 | $22.4M | -$3.2M | $-2.25 |
| Q3 2025 | $29.3M | -$3.1M | $-1.72 |
| Q2 2025 | $30.9M | -$1.5M | $-0.92 |
| Q3 2024 | $36.3M | -$3.1M | $-0.34 |
| Q2 2024 | $38.5M | -$811.0K | $-0.12 |
| Q1 2024 | $37.1M | -$2.9M | $-0.35 |
| Q3 2023 | $49.7M | -$1.7M | $0.28 |
| Q2 2023 | $47.1M | $26.0K | $-0.04 |
Data sourced from SEC EDGAR 10-Q quarterly filings. Figures may represent quarterly or cumulative values.
